    I bedded my stringers in a Grady the other way. Marked the line on the hull with a marker and place the CSM fibers, Cabosil, and I used Polyester. Then laid the stringers in. Had about a half inch bed for the stringers as you do not want them on touching the hull. I laid them in just enough to start to Ozzy and then created a nice taper line for the 1708 to lay in flat.
